Adrian can now show off 11 landslide victories after their most recent game on Friday. Their pitchers stepped up to hand the Dundee Vikings a 9-0 shutout. Adrian's pitching crew has been rock solid lately; the team hasn't given up a run in their last five matches.
Julius Robichaud made a big impact while hitting and pitching. He looked comfortable on the mound, not allowing a single earned run and only two hits while striking out seven over six innings pitched. Robichaud has been consistent recently: he hasn't tossed less than five strikeouts in four consecutive pitching appearances. Robichaud was also big at the plate, going 2-for-4 with a double and an RBI.
In other batting news, the team relied heavily on Tyler Bruggeman, who scored two runs and stole a base while going 3-for-5. Joelden Griffin was another key contributor, scoring a run while going 1-for-3.
Adrian is on a roll lately: they've won nine of their last 11 matchups, which provided a nice bump to their 16-4 record this season. As for Dundee, their defeat was their fourth straight at home, which dropped their record down to 9-8.
Both teams are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. Adrian will take on Tecumseh at 4:00 p.m. on Monday. Adrian's pitching crew has only allowed 2.6 runs per game this season, so Tecumseh's hitters will have their work cut out for them. As for Dundee, their homestand will continue as they prepare to take on Madison at 4:00 p.m. on Tuesday.
